On Fri, Nov 12, 2004 at 03:24:16PM +0100, Jean-Bruno Luginb�hl wrote:
> Merci Felix pour toutes ces explications. Mais, hum, comment dirais-je,
> je suis relativement n�ophite dans ce domaine et ne connais pas grand
> chose. Donc je vois la commande, mais ou dois-je l'indiquer au syst�me

Ce que t'as expliqu� F�lix, c'est comment g�n�rer un fichier de sortie
pour ton imprimante depuis un fichier PostScript.

Le test sera alors simple:

    cat ce_fichier_de_sortie > /dev/lp0  # imprimante parall�le

Si cela fonctionne, alors mets ces commandes dans un script, comme le
script suivant:


   #! /bin/sh

   gs -sDEVICE=ljet4 -r600 -sOutputFile=- -q -dSAFER -

ensuite, installe lprng � la place de CUPS (c'est plus simple pour faire
ce qui pr�c�de -- encore qu'en th�orie �a doit �tre possible aussi avec
CUPS) et modifie /etc/printcap ainsi:


   lp2|pcl|ljet_1300_pcl|HP LaserJet 1300 PCL:\
        :lp=/dev/lp0:sd=/var/spool/lpd/ljet_1300:\
        :sh:mx#0:\
        :if=/some/path/to/lj1300_print.sh:\
        :af=/var/log/lp-acct:lf=/var/log/lp-errs:
  
Remarques:
   - coller � la marge gauche le script et la config princap
   - adapter /some/path/to
   - ne pas oublier le droit d'ex�cution sur le script

PS: si tu pr�f�res utiliser l'usine-�-gaz CUPS, il te faut alors trouver
comment ins�rer un script de pstoraster dans CUPS (peut-�tre F�lix nous
l'expliquera).

PS/2: comme on a d�j� discut� ici, le concept d'usine � gaz et relatif:
je trouve que deux lignes de shell sont moins usine-�-gaz que CUPS,
personnellement.

_______________________________________________
gull mailing list
[EMAIL PROTECTED]
http://lists.alphanet.ch/mailman/listinfo/gull

Répondre à